Understanding Name Badges
Name badges are identification tags typically worn on clothing that display a person’s name, designation, or department. They may also feature your company’s logo, tagline, or even a QR code. These badges can be made of various materials such as plastic, metal, acrylic, or paper, depending on the usage and brand aesthetic.
Types of Name Badges
-
Permanent Name Badges
These are custom-designed badges for long-term employees or staff members. They often feature a professional look and are made of durable materials like metal or engraved plastic. -
Reusable Name Badges
Ideal for temporary staff or frequent events, these badges have insertable name cards and are perfect for organizations that experience high turnover or host many events. -
Magnetic Name Badges
These use a magnetic back instead of a pin, preventing damage to clothes. They're commonly used in retail, hospitality, and corporate settings. -
Button Badges
These are more casual and often used in promotional events or volunteer programs. -
Digital or Smart Name Badges
Integrated with NFC or QR codes, these high-tech badges are increasingly used in tech events or networking sessions.
Benefits of Using Name Badges in Business
1. Improves Customer Trust and Service
When a customer walks into a store or interacts with your team, they want to know who they are speaking to. A name badge with the employee’s name and role instantly creates a sense of trust and transparency.
2. Boosts Professionalism
Wearing name badges gives your business a polished and professional appearance. It shows that your team is part of a cohesive unit and takes their job seriously.
3. Encourages Accountability
When employees wear name badges, they are more likely to be aware of their actions. It creates a level of accountability because their identity is known to customers and colleagues alike.
4. Facilitates Networking
At events or conferences, name badges act as icebreakers. They make it easier for attendees to start conversations, remember names, and build meaningful business relationships.
5. Enhances Security
In large organizations or at crowded events, name badges help identify authorized personnel, limiting access to certain areas and increasing overall security.

Designing the Perfect Name Badge
When it comes to designing name badges, several factors come into play:
1. Readability
Ensure the name is in a large, easy-to-read font. Avoid overly decorative fonts that can be difficult to read from a distance.
2. Brand Consistency
Incorporate your company logo and brand colors. This not only reinforces your brand but also makes the badge look more professional.
3. Material Quality
Choose durable and lightweight materials that are comfortable for daily wear.
4. Attachment Style
Whether you opt for a pin, clip, lanyard, or magnet, choose a style that fits your workplace needs and ensures comfort for the wearer.
5. Customization Options
Allow space for job titles, departments, or QR codes for added functionality.

Digital Innovations in Name Badges
With the rise of smart technologies, name badges are no longer just static ID tags. Today, companies are experimenting with:
-
QR Codes and NFC Tags for quick access to contact info or company profiles
-
LED Name Badges that display scrolling names and titles for tech-savvy events
-
Augmented Reality (AR) Integration, allowing users to scan a badge and see a video intro or portfolio
These innovations add a new layer of engagement and interactivity to traditional name badges.

Cost of Name Badges
Name badges are generally affordable, but pricing can vary based on:
-
Material (metal badges are more expensive than plastic)
-
Customization (logos, colors, and designs add to the cost)
-
Quantity (bulk orders usually come with discounts)
-
Features (magnetic back, QR code, or smart tech increases the price)
